Full Job Description
Responsibilities

As an OFCI Manager, you’ll oversee owner-furnished equipment from ordering through site delivery, installation, and final testing.

 

HazTek is seeking an experienced OFCI Manager in Houston, TX to manage critical equipment lifecycles on a large-scale construction project. This role is essential in coordinating vendors, tracking equipment deliveries, avoiding site delays, and ensuring all gear is ready for startup and handover.

 

  • Defines equipment requirements and manages vendor delivery timelines
  • Coordinates equipment shipments, site receiving, storage, and contractor handoffs
  • Tracks vendor startup support, controls integration, and integrated systems testing (Levels 2–5)
  • Identifies supply chain risks early and works with site teams to prevent installation delays
  • Maintains complete equipment logs, including serial numbers, warranties, and spare parts
